Educational Disadvantage.

Dáil Éireann Debate, Thursday - 14 October 2004

Thursday, 14 October 2004

Ceisteanna (137)

Jim O'Keeffe

Ceist:

137 Mr. J. O’Keeffe asked the Minister for Education and Science the position regarding the future of the GCEB co-ordinator for four schools in west Cork; if her attention has been drawn to the fact that the scheme has had a very positive influence on the school community over the past eight years; and if the scheme will be continued in the area covered by Togher, Kealkil and Coomhola national schools and ScoilMocomóg [24930/04]

Amharc ar fhreagra

Freagraí scríofa

My Department is currently finalising a review of educational disadvantage schemes with a view to building on what has been achieved to date, adopting a more systematic, targeted and integrated approach and strengthening the capacity of the system to meet the educational needs of disadvantaged children and young people. The future position of the scheme referred to by the Deputy will be clarified in the context of this review.
